Track: Martinsville Speedway

Event: Kroger 200 – 200 laps / 105.2 miles

When: Saturday, October 29th at 2:00 PM (Eastern)

Broadcast information: 2:00 PM (Eastern) SPEED, SIRIUSXM, MRN Radio

Lofton, ESR Ready for Martinsville Short Track

Last race review: Last week at Talladega Superspeedway, Justin Lofton and the CollegeComplete.com Eddie Sharp Racing team tallied a solid finish in their No. 6 Chevrolet Silverado after embracing a sometimes risky strategy at the famed superspeedway. Lofton started the event from the 16th position and despite six caution flags halting the race, avoided the trouble that racing within the draft often brings, and finished a solid 11th.

Lofton at Martinsville: Lofton has raced at the .526-mile paperclip shaped Martinsville Speedway short track three times leading up to this weekend’s race. In 2010, Lofton tallied a best finish of 13th in the fall event. In April, Lofton’s run there was similar to his first, after a lapped truck made contact with his machine, causing him to suffer heavy damage. He was forced behind the wall for 80 laps for repairs before rejoining the race.

Lofton on Martinsville: “Martinsville has always been a challenge for us because the racing is so tight there. It is hard to avoid the lapped traffic there and it’s bit us a few times. We’re taking a good truck this week and I am really looking forward to it. We have the speed, we just need some luck to play on our side too.”

Truck information: Lofton will race chassis 133 this weekend at Martinsville. He last raced the truck in September in Loudon. He started the event seventh and ended the day 13th. He previously raced this chassis in Bristol and drove from deep in the field from 29th to an impressive seventh place finish, his highest finish to date this season.

Tournament time: Plans for the Second Annual Justin Lofton Charity Golf Tournament are beginning to take shape, with dates being set for January 6th and 7th, 2012. The tournament, as it was last year, will take place in Lofton’s native California, at the Del Rio Country Club in Brawley, California. All proceeds from the event will benefit the Boys and Girls Club of Imperial Valley. The two-day event includes autograph sessions, golfing, a dinner, live concert with Curb recording artist Tim Dugger, and a charity auction. Last year Lofton raised $40,000 for the Boys and Girls Clubs.
